## 内容主体大纲1. 引言 1.1 区块链技术的兴起 1.2 跨平台技术的必要性 1.3 王高飞的研究背景 2. 区块链基础知识 2.1 什...
随着数字化经济的不断发展,区块链技术逐渐成为一种基础设施,改变着金融、供应链、医疗等多个行业的服务模式。区块链不仅提升了数据透明度和安全性,也促进了业务的去中心化,然而,市场上涌现出的众多区块链平台让用户面临选择困境。那么,究竟哪个区块链平台好用且安全呢?本文将深入探讨这个问题。
### 什么是区块链平台?区块链平台是指基于区块链技术构建的为用户提供去中心化应用和服务的基础设施。其核心成分包括节点、网络、共识机制、智能合约和数据存储等。借助这些元素,开发者能够创建各种应用,如去中心化交易所、数字身份验证系统等。
区块链平台可以分为公有链、私有链和联盟链。公有链允许任何人参与,典型应用有比特币、以太坊等;私有链则是企业内部使用,限制参与者,常用于企业间的协作;联盟链则是由多个实体共同维护,适合标准化合作需求。
### 区块链平台的安全性要素加密技术是区块链安全的基石,确保数据在传输过程中的完整性与隐私。常见的加密方法包括对称加密和非对称加密。区块链利用哈希算法确保每个区块数据的不可篡改,有效降低了未授权访问的风险。
共识机制是区块链网络中节点达成一致的规则,常见的机制有工作量证明(PoW)和权益证明(PoS)。它们各有优劣,PoW虽然安全但耗电量大,PoS则节能但在分配经济利益时可能出现集中化趋势。
智能合约是自动执行协议,安全漏洞可能被黑客利用,造成资产损失。因此,开发中需要遵循最佳实践,如代码审核和形式验证,确保智能合约的安全性,以及在链上部署时进行充分的测试。
### 关于流行区块链平台的功能和优缺点以太坊是一个公有链平台,支持智能合约的创建。优点在于其庞大的开发者社区和丰富的生态系统,但交易费用时常上涨,可能影响用户体验。同时,PoW的共识机制也导致环保担忧。
超级账本是由Linux基金会创建的联盟链项目,适合企业环境。其优势在于灵活的模块化架构和高性能,但由于编程语言较为复杂,开发门槛较高,可能制约小型企业的使用。
EOS旨在解决可扩展性问题,支持高并发的交易处理。其缺点是节点中心化较为明显,可能对网络的安全性造成影响。此外,未成熟的治理体系也使得平台面临风险。
波卡是一个可以实现不同区块链之间通信的网络,具有极高的灵活性和扩展性。但作为一个相对新兴的平台,其生态系统相对较小,开发者支持也在逐步构建中。
### 如何选择合适的区块链平台?在选择区块链平台时,首先需要明确使用的场景和需求。如果需求涉及透明性与去中心化,那么公有链是合适的选择;反之,若涉及隐私和控制权,则私有链会更合适。
评估区块链平台的安全性可以从多个方面进行考量,包括其加密技术的可靠性、共识机制的优势、智能合约的安全性、历史安全事件及其处理情况等。选择历史安全问题较少的平台,可以提高使用的信心。
一个活跃的开发者社区往往意味着该平台持续更新与,能够解决用户在使用中的问题。此外,成熟的平台通常拥有更多的应用场景与用户案例,为新用户提供更好的参考。
### 未来区块链平台的技术趋势DeFi正在成为区块链技术应用的重要领域,通过智能合约提供无需中介的金融服务。大多数DeFi项目基于以太坊,但随着多链相互连接的技术的不断成熟,未来的DeFi生态可能会更加多样。
随着各类区块链的兴起,跨链技术的需求日益显著。通过跨链技术,不同区块链能够实现数据共享与资产转移,这将提升区块链的适用範围与灵活性,推动更多商业应用的落地。
未来区块链将与物联网(IoT)和人工智能(AI)深度融合,通过区块链保障IoT设备的数据安全及隐私,而利用AI进行数据分析与决策,也将成为提高运营效率的重要手段。
### 结论在选择安全且好用的区块链平台时,应综合考虑平台的安全性、功能、社区支持等多个因素。随着区块链技术不断发展,未来将会有更多新的平台及应用场景出现,用户应保持关注并根据自身具体需求做出选择。
--- ### 相关问题与详细介绍 1. **为什么安全性对区块链平台至关重要?** 2. **对比不同区块链平台的优缺点,如何进行选择?** 3. **区块链平台的技术架构是怎样的?** 4. **智能合约的安全漏洞通常有哪些,如何避免?** 5. **区块链技术在金融领域的应用有哪些?** 6. **未来区块链技术的发展趋势如何?** 接下来可以针对每个问题进行深入详细的介绍,每个问题约600字。请根据需要继续向我询问或深入探讨具体内容!